What is a Digital Brochure?
A digital brochure is a type of marketing material that uses digital technologies to create, distribute, and engage with customers. It is a digital version of a traditional brochure, designed to be viewed on various devices such as computers, tablets, and smartphones. Digital brochures are often used by businesses to promote their products, services, and brand, and to reach a wider audience.
History of Digital Brochures
The concept of digital brochures dates back to the 1990s, when the first digital brochures were created using software such as Adobe FrameMaker. However, it wasn’t until the early 2000s that digital brochures became a popular marketing tool. The rise of the internet and the increasing use of digital technologies made it possible for businesses to create and distribute digital brochures easily and efficiently.
Key Features of Digital Brochures
Digital brochures have several key features that make them an effective marketing tool. Here are some of the most important features:
- Interactive Content: Digital brochures can include interactive content such as videos, animations, and quizzes, which can engage the reader and make the content more memorable.
- Mobile Optimization: Digital brochures are designed to be viewed on various devices, including smartphones and tablets. This means that they can be easily accessed and viewed on the go.
- Search Engine Optimization (SEO): Digital brochures can be optimized for search engines, making it easier for customers to find them when searching for products or services online.
- Email Marketing Integration: Digital brochures can be easily integrated with email marketing campaigns, allowing businesses to send targeted promotions and offers to their customers.
- Social Media Sharing: Digital brochures can be easily shared on social media platforms, allowing businesses to reach a wider audience and increase their online presence.
Benefits of Digital Brochures
Digital brochures offer several benefits to businesses, including:
- Increased Reach: Digital brochures can be easily distributed to a wide audience, including customers, prospects, and partners.
- Improved Engagement: Interactive content and mobile optimization make digital brochures more engaging and interactive, increasing the chances of capturing the reader’s attention.
- Cost-Effective: Digital brochures are often cheaper to produce and distribute than traditional brochures, making them a cost-effective marketing tool.
- Measurable Results: Digital brochures can be tracked and measured, providing businesses with valuable insights into their marketing efforts.
